Introduction: The world of Guardians of Ga’Hoole

Guardians of Ga’Hoole is a young adult fantasy series written by American author Kathryn Lasky. The series takes place in a world inhabited by talking owls and centers around a group of owls called the Guardians of Ga’Hoole, who are tasked with protecting the owl kingdom from evil forces. The original series: A 15-book journey

The original Guardians of Ga’Hoole series consists of 15 books, beginning with The Capture and ending with The War of the Ember. The series follows the journey of a young barn owl named Soren, who is kidnapped and taken to a dark and sinister place called St. Aegolius Academy for Orphaned Owls. Soren escapes and embarks on a quest to save the owl kingdom from the evil forces that threaten it.

The spin-off series: A continuation of the story

Following the conclusion of the original series, Lasky continued the story with a spin-off series called Wolves of the Beyond. The series takes place in the same world as Guardians of Ga’Hoole, but with a focus on wolves instead of owls. The series follows the journey of a young wolf named Faolan, who is born with a deformed paw and struggles to find his place in his pack. The series explores themes of identity, belonging, and the power of friendship.
